Construction project management: theory and practice

By: Jha, Neeraj KumarMaterial type: TextTextPublication details: New Delhi Pearson India Education Services Pvt. Ltd. 2022 Edition: 2ndDescription: xxiii, 878 pISBN: 9789332542013Subject(s): Project managementDDC classification: 624 Summary: The revised second edition of Construction Project Management discusses the various facets of construction project management with a special emphasis on fundamental concepts. The major principles of project management are explained with the help of real-life case studies. Simple examples are used to facilitate a better understanding of basic concepts before complex problems are discussed.

Table of content

1. Introduction


2. Project Organization


3. Construction Economics


4. Client's Estimation of Project Cost


5. Construction Contract


6. Construction Planning


7. Project Scheduling and Resource Levelling


8. Contractor's Estimation of Cost and Bidding Strategy


9. Construction Equipment Management


10. Construction Accounts Management


11. Construction Material Management


12. Project Cost and Value Management


13. Construction Quality Management


14. Risk and Insurance in Construction


15. Construction Safety Management


16. Project Monitoring and Control System


17. Construction Claims, Disputes, and Project Closure


18. Computer Applications in Scheduling, Resource Levelling, Monitoring, and Reporting


19. Factors Behind the Success of a Construction Project


20. Linear programming


21. Transportation, transshipment and assignment problems
